Abstract
The invention belongs to the technical field of machine design, and relates to a fuse weaving device which comprises a pull handle, a pull rod, a connecting nut, a sleeve, a connecting rod, a pressing cap and a fuse clamp. The pull handle and the pull rod are integrally fixed, the pull rod is located in the sleeve and provided with a rotating groove, and outer threads are arranged on the inner wall of the sleeve and matched with the rotating groove. The connecting nut is a bearing structure, the inner ring of the bearing structure is arranged on the sleeve in a sleeved mode and is fixedly connected with the sleeve, the connecting rod is mounted at the bottom of the sleeve, the pressing cap is a ring with a frustum-shaped hole in the middle, and the connecting rod is sleeved with the pressing cap. The fuse clamp and the connecting rod are fixed, and fuse locking grooves are symmetrically formed in the two sides of the fuse clamp. The fuse weaving device is used for weaving a fuse, time and labor are saved, and work efficiency of weaving bolt fuses can be greatly improved.

Background technology
At present, in the time that bolt is worn to fuse, be mainly method by hand, through after a bolt, wire is wound in to twisted shape mutually with hand vice, then wear next bolt, then wire is coiled into twisted shape with hand vice, until one group of bolt has all been worn.Its shortcoming is: wearing by hand in process wiry, because wire is to have certain degree of hardness, and the dynamics using also can not be consistent, so volume fried dough twist shape is out also variant, therefore cause fuse braiding speed slow, shape is lack of standardization, and outward appearance is plain.The more important thing is, because the fuse degree of tightness of putting on is inconsistent, likely do not have the effect of insurance.

Carrying out before fuse braiding, first apparatus for assembling, is enclosed within clamping cap 8 on connecting rod 7, then connecting rod is tightened.
Specific implementation process: two terminations of the fuse material of needs braiding are placed on respectively in the lock silk groove 9 arranging on wired 10, then clamping cap 8 is moved down and is pressed on fuse, because wired 10 two sides are taper types, and the inner ring type face of clamping cap 8 is consistent with wired 10 two sides profiles, so push to and just completed fixing to braid after being pressed in fuse when clamping cap 8, and can draw tighter and tighter, then holding handle 1 is firmly pulled outwardly the pull bar 2 all pushing in sleeve 6, in the process that pulls pull bar, because sleeve is fixed together with attaching nut 4, and ball is housed in attaching nut 4, so sleeve can rotate in the time being subject to the guiding of helicla flute 3 on pull bar, the rotation of sleeve just drives the connecting rod 7 of bottom to rotate, make to be fixed on the fuse rotation in lock silk groove 9, the material being locked in silk groove is woven into twisted shape.
